The utility model discloses a casting grinding device, which comprises a workbench, a support plate is fixedly installed at the lower part of the front end of the workbench, a motor is fixedly installed at the middle of the upper end of the support plate, and a connection box is fixedly installed at the left part of the upper end of the workbench , the right end of the connection box is provided with an air outlet, the middle of the upper end of the worktable is provided with a grinding roller, the right side of the worktable is placed with a receiving box, and the upper right end of the worktable is fixedly connected with two sets of connecting rods, the connecting rods are One end of the rod away from the worktable is fixedly connected with a vertical plate, the upper left end of the vertical plate is fixedly connected with a horizontal plate, the front and rear of the lower end of the horizontal plate are fixedly connected with spring ropes, and the lower ends of the two sets of spring ropes are fixedly connected. A clamping device is fixedly connected together, and a first shaft rod and a second shaft rod are arranged in the worktable. The casting grinding device of the utility model is convenient for clamping and fixing the casting, can arbitrarily adjust the grinding angle of the casting, and can protect the surrounding environment to a certain extent.

与现有技术相比,本实用新型具有如下有益效果:Compared with the prior art, the utility model has the following beneficial effects:

1、通过设置有电机,电机带动第二转轴转动从而能够带动固定安装在第二转轴外壁上的扇叶转动,产生的风力向上进入到连接箱中,再从出风口吹出,能够将在打磨时产生的大量碎屑吹除,并通过竖直板阻拦,最后落入到承接箱中,能够防止打磨时碎屑对周边环境产生的污染。1. By being provided with a motor, the motor drives the second shaft to rotate so as to drive the fan blades fixed on the outer wall of the second shaft to rotate, and the generated wind enters the connection box upwards, and then blows out from the air outlet, which can be used for grinding. A large amount of debris generated is blown off, blocked by the vertical plate, and finally falls into the receiving box, which can prevent the debris from polluting the surrounding environment during grinding.

2、通过设置有夹持组件,进行打磨前根据铸件的长度调整活动板的位置,然后转动第一转盘将铸件夹持在第一挡板和第二挡板之间,向下按压安装板即可将铸件紧贴打磨辊,达到打磨铸件的目的,同时通过转动第二转盘能够将铸件旋转,标语调节打磨角度。2. By setting the clamping component, adjust the position of the movable plate according to the length of the casting before grinding, and then turn the first turntable to clamp the casting between the first baffle and the second baffle, and press the mounting plate downward. The casting can be closely attached to the grinding roller to achieve the purpose of grinding the casting. At the same time, the casting can be rotated by rotating the second turntable, and the grinding angle can be adjusted.

需要说明的是,本实用新型为一种铸件打磨装置,在使用前接通外界电源,工作人员将限位杆26从第一通孔24中取下,根据需要进行打磨的铸件形状和尺寸将活动板14调节到合适的位置,然后将限位杆26插入到第一通孔24和第二通孔22中将活动板14与安装板13相对固定,手持铸件将其位于第一挡板17与第二挡板21之间,调节第一转盘15将铸件固定,打开电机3的开关使其工作,按压安装板13,两组弹簧绳10伸长,电机3通过主齿轮28和第二副齿轮29以及第一轴杆31带动打磨辊5转动,将铸件紧贴打磨辊5外壁即可进行打磨,电机3通过主齿轮28、第一副齿轮30和第二轴杆32带动固定安装在第二轴杆32外壁上的扇叶33转动,产生的风力进入到连接箱4中并通过出风口12吹出,从而对进行打磨时产生的大量碎屑进行清理,将碎屑吹到竖直板8上然后落入到承接箱6中进行收集,在打磨完成后只需抽出限位杆26即可将铸件取下。It should be noted that the present utility model is a casting grinding device. Before use, the external power supply is turned on, and the staff removes the limit rod 26 from the first through hole 24, and the shape and size of the casting to be ground as required will be Adjust the movable plate 14 to an appropriate position, and then insert the limit rod 26 into the first through hole 24 and the second through hole 22 to fix the movable plate 14 and the mounting plate 13 relative to each other, and hold the casting to locate it on the first baffle 17 Between it and the second baffle 21, adjust the first turntable 15 to fix the casting, turn on the switch of the motor 3 to make it work, press the mounting plate 13, the two sets of spring ropes 10 are stretched, and the motor 3 passes through the main gear 28 and the second pair of The gear 29 and the first shaft 31 drive the grinding roller 5 to rotate, and the casting can be ground close to the outer wall of the grinding roller 5. The motor 3 is driven by the main gear 28, the first auxiliary gear 30 and the second shaft 32 to be fixedly installed on the second shaft. The fan blades 33 on the outer wall of the two shaft rods 32 rotate, and the generated wind power enters the connection box 4 and is blown out through the air outlet 12, so as to clean up a large amount of debris generated during grinding, and blow the debris to the vertical plate 8 Then it falls into the receiving box 6 for collection, and after grinding is completed, only the limit rod 26 is pulled out to remove the casting.
